Senior software engg / Technical lead Java
Posted on May 22, 2025
Job Description
- JOB DESCRIPTION
- Senior software engg / Technical lead Java
- * Strong knowledge of cloud-native technologies, including Docker and Kubernetes.
- * Experience with building and managing CI/CD pipelines.
- * Hands-on expertise in messaging and streaming systems such as Kafka.
- * Practical experience with NoSQL databases, specifically MongoDB and Redis.Well versed with delivery JAVA/J2EE projects.
- * Experienced in estimation and good understanding of SDLC.
- * Excellent client-facing and internal communication skills.
- * Excellent written and verbal communication skills.
- * Solid organizational skills include attention to detail and multi-tasking skills. Preferred Qualifications:
- * PMP, Scrum Master, or other relevant project management certifications.
- * Experience with cloud platforms like AWS or GCP.
- * Knowledge of monitoring and logging tools (e.g., Prometheus, Grafana, ELK stack).
- * Familiarity with Test-Driven Development (TDD) and DevOps culture.
- Job Overview We are a dynamic and fast-growing company specializing in Logistics and Supply chain. We are looking for a Automation Tester to join our team and contribute to our continued success. This is an exciting opportunity to work on cutting-edge technologies and ensure high-quality software for our clients.
- Key Responsibilities:
- * Develop and maintain automated test scripts to ensure the quality of software products.
- * Collaborate closely with development and QA teams to understand project requirements.
- * Identify, log, and resolve defects in coordination with developers.
- * Enhance existing test frameworks to improve testing efficiency and coverage.
- Required Skills & Qualifications:
- * Basic Programming Skills: Proficiency in one of the following: Java, Python, or JavaScript.
- * Expertise in Automation Frameworks: Hands-on experience with tools like Selenium, Cypress, etc.
- * API Testing Knowledge: Familiarity with API testing and tools such as Postman.
- * Design and implement automated test scripts for functional, regression, and performance testing.
- * Develop and maintain a comprehensive suite of automated tests for new and existing applications.
- * Collaborate with developers to understand application features and create test plans.
- * Identify, document, and track defects, and collaborate with the development team to resolve issues. � Analyze test results, report issues, and provide insights on test coverage and product quality.
- * Continuously improve and optimize the test automation framework for efficiency and scalability.
Required Skills
ci/cd
kafka
mongodb